Abstract

BACKGROUND: MicroRNA-146a (miRNA-146a) can mediate the proliferation of immune cells and tumor cells through negative regulation of nuclear factor κB signaling pathway, but whether miRNA-146a participates in the proliferation or apoptosis of vascular smooth muscle cells (VSMCs) has not been reported.OBJECTIVE: To investigate the role of miRNA-146a in VSMCs proliferation and apoptosis and to exploit its mechanisms. METHODS: Artificial synthesized miRNA-146a antisense oligonucleotide (ASO, 50 nmol/L), scramble (control, 50nmol/l) and phosphate buffered saline (normal) were transfected into VSMCs by Lipofectamine 2000 individually. RESULTS AND CONCLUSION: By the end of 48 hours of transfection, there were significantly lower levels of miRNA-146a mRNA in ASO treated VSMCs compared with that in normal and control VSMCs (P < 0.01). Meanwhile, ASO treated VSMCs manifested a lower proliferative (P < 0.01) and higher apoptotic ability (P < 0.05). The protein level of nuclear factor-κBp65 and proliferation cell nuclear antigen in ASO treated VSMCs were remarkably lower than that in normal and control VSMCs (P < 0.05). miRNA-146a is capable of promoting proliferation and suppressing apoptosis of VMSCs, which is probably related with the increase in nuclear factor-κBp65 expression.
